STUTZMAN v. MADISON CTY. BD. OF ELECTIONS

No. 01-1669.

93 Ohio St.3d 511 (2001)

STUTZMAN v. MADISON COUNTY BOARD OF ELECTIONS ET AL.

Supreme Court of Ohio.

Decided October 11, 2001.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Donald J. McTigue, for relator.

Stephen J. Pronai, Madison County Prosecuting Attorney, for respondents.


LUNDBERG STRATTON, J.

On April 23, 2001, the Council of the Village of Plain City, Ohio, enacted Ordinance No. 06-01, which rezones approximately 89.425 acres of land owned by relator, Henry J. Stutzman, to RS3 Single Family Residential District. The title of Ordinance No. 06-01 is:
